Iron(III) sulfite has the formula
a) Fe₃SO₃
b) Fe₂(SO₄)₃
c) Fe₂(SO₃)₃
d) Fe₂SO₄
e) Fe₂SO₃

Respuesta :

jydclix
jydclix jydclix
  • 11-04-2014
option C= Fe2(SO3)3
interchanged oxidation number[Fe]3+[SO3]2-
